**Ticket: Session refresh failing in plugin sandbox**

Several Marrowfield plugin authors report sessions expiring despite valid refresh calls. Root cause: sandbox environments were provisioned without the refresh-signing secret, so the token service rejects renewal requests with a generic 401. Affected plugins should not change any code. The fix is config-only: add the missing entry to your sandbox env file, specifically this line:

env line for yahip-tafog: RELAY_SECRET3=4ca

Handover Note — Logistics Transition

From Director Maren Holt to Director Calix Reyes, for the sales leads: effective next quarter we move from Varstrom Freight to Quillhaven Logistics. Contracts, SLAs, and escalation paths are documented in the shared binder. Please brief your teams carefully, as delivery windows shift by one day in the Ostwick region. The rationale appears in the confidential note below.

confidential, kagep-kahof: Druokax Systems plans to lower the Ulaath list price by 53 percent in March.

**Action item (INC-committee, Pondrel queue outage):** our compaction job fell behind for three days and nobody noticed until brokers ran out of disk. New folks: compaction lag is now a first-class metric with its own alert, owned by the Kestrel rotation. We also lowered the segment size so catch-up is faster. The tuning values we settled on are below.

constants for bawif-kawif:
QUOTAS = {
    "ulaael": 5,
    "holael": 10,
}

## Step 4: Upgrade Fabrikka

Fabrikka, our test-data factory library, moves from v2 to v3 in this release. Release managers should note that v3 generates deterministic seeds by default, which changes fixture output in CI. Regenerate golden files before promoting the build. Once fixtures are regenerated, point the pipeline at the v3 registry using the configuration values below.

service settings:
PRAIX_LOG_LEVEL=error
PRAIX_METRICS_HOST=metrics.praix.qorvelcorp.corp
PRAIX_POOL_SIZE=16